Ingredients
Scale
- 1 lb lean ground beef
- 1 lb ground pork
- 1 cup breadcrumbs (plain or seasoned)
- 1 medium onion (finely chopped)
- 3 cloves garlic (minced)
- 2 tbsp fresh dill (or 1 tbsp dried)
- ½ tsp nutmeg (freshly grated)
- 4 cups low-sodium chicken broth
- 1 cup heavy cream
- Salt and pepper to taste
Instructions
- In a large bowl, combine ground beef, ground pork, breadcrumbs, onion, garlic, dill, nutmeg, salt, and pepper. Mix gently until well combined.
- Heat a skillet over medium heat with a splash of oil. Form small meatballs from the mixture and brown on all sides.
- In a large pot, bring chicken broth to a gentle simmer. Scrape any browned bits from the skillet into the pot for added flavor.
- Add the browned meatballs to the simmering broth and stir in the heavy cream until smooth.
- Taste and adjust seasoning as needed before serving hot with crusty bread.
- Prep Time: 15 minutes
- Cook Time: 30 minutes
